Understanding the Basics: What is Biomechanics and Mathematical Modeling?

Before we explore the practical applications, it’s essential to have a clear grasp of what these terms mean. Biomechanics is the study of the mechanics of living organisms, particularly the forces and movements involved in human motion. Mathematical modeling, on the other hand, involves using mathematical language to describe the behavior of a system. When these two fields intersect, they create a powerful toolset for analyzing and optimizing human movement.

# Case Study 1: Maximizing Athletic Performance

Professional athletes often seek to enhance their performance by optimizing their movements and strength. A sports team might use this programme to analyze the biomechanics of a star player’s technique. By applying mathematical models to their training regimen, they can identify areas for improvement, such as more efficient stride patterns or better coordination between different muscle groups. This not only helps in achieving better results but also in reducing the risk of injury.

# Case Study 2: Enhancing Rehabilitation Outcomes

In the medical field, the application of biomechanics and mathematical modeling can significantly improve patient outcomes. A patient recovering from a knee injury might benefit from a tailored rehabilitation program based on these principles. A physiotherapist can use advanced modeling techniques to simulate the movements that the patient needs to perform and to predict potential complications. This allows for a more personalized and effective recovery plan, ultimately leading to faster and more successful rehabilitation.
